European Physical Journal A | 1994

Production of isomeric44V and42Sc in high energy heavy ion reactions

H. Keller; V. Borrel; D. Guillemaud-Mueller; A. C. Mueller; F. Pougheon; O. Sorlin; P. Baumann; F. Didierjean; A. Huck; A. Knipper; G. Walter; R. Anne; D. Bazin; M. Lewitowicz; M. G. Saint-Laurent; G. Marguier

Beta-coincidentγ-rays were measured from implanted44V and42Sc nuclei. These were selected after58Ni+nickel reactions by means of the LISE3 spectrometer at GANIL. The production of the isomeric states was identified by detecting their typicalβ-delayedγ-ray cascades. From the intensities of the detectedγ-lines the ratio between isomer and ground-state production of44V follows to be 1 to 3.0(4).


European Physical Journal A | 1994

TheN=83 nucleus149Dy from Gamow-Teller decay of its 11/2− and 1/2+149Ho parents

R. Menegazzo; P. Kleinheinz; R. Collatz; H. H. Güven; J. Styczen; D. Schardt; H. Keller; O. Klepper; G. Walter; A. Huck; G. Marguier; J. Blomqvist

A high-sensitivityγ-spectroscopic study of the149Hoπh11/2 andπs1/2β-decays using mass separated sources has located dominant 0+ → 1+ GT decay strength associated with decay of pairedh11/2 protons, leading to 3п-states in the149Dy daughter nucleus. In theirγ-decay low-lying149Dy levels characteristic of anN=83 nucleus are excited. They include theνf7/2,νp3/2,νh9/2 andνp1/2 single particle- and theνs12/−1 andνd32/−1 two-particle one-hole states, as well as the νf7/2 × 3− andνf7/2 × 2+ particle-phonon multiplets. A synopsis is given of these excitations in theN=83 isotones from149Nd to153Yb. The149Dy GT decay strength is discussed in terms of the147Tb82 and148Dy82 decays. The strength function results are also compared with independent149Ho 11/2− decay data from the literature based on totalγ-ray absorption measurements.


European Physical Journal A | 1989

Gamow-teller strength and particle-phonon states in149Dy from decay of its 11/2− and l/2+149Ho parents

R. Menegazzo; H. H. Güven; J. Styczen; N. Roy; P. Kleinheinz; D. Schardt; R. Barden; G. Walter; A. Huck; G. Marguier; J. Blomqvist

Studies of the149Ho 11/2− and 1/2+ GT-decays using on-line mass separation have established in the N=83149Dy nucleus the single neutron excitations below 1.8 MeV and members of the νf7/2×3− and νf7/2×2+ particle-phonon multiplets. Quantitative analysis of the GT-decay strength to149Dy 1qp- and 3qp-states is made in terms of the strength values measured in149Dy0 and147Tb11/2− decay.


Nuclei Far From Stability: 5th International Conference | 2008

Gamow‐Teller beta decay of 29–31Na comparison with shell‐model estimates

P. Baumann; Ph. Dessagne; A. Huck; G. Klotz; A. Knipper; Ch. Miehé; M. Ramdane; Granger, Walter, .; G. Marguier; J. Giroux; C. Richard-Serre

Gamma rays and delayed‐neutron processes subsequent to beta decay of the neutron‐rich 29–31Na isotopes are studied in singles an coincidence mode with mass‐separated sources at ISOLDE. Improved level schemes are presented for mass 29 and 30, whose features substantially agree with shell‐model predictions. The deduced Gamow‐Teller strengths are discussed as well as the occurrence of negative parity intruder states in the daughter nuclei.


Nuclei Far From Stability: 5th International Conference | 2008

Experimental mass excess of 49,50K and 40,42Cl

Ch. Miehé; Ph. Dessagne; P. Baumann; A. Huck; G. Klotz; A. Knipper; Granger, Walter, .; C. Richard-Serre; G. Marguier

Detection of the β–decay of fission fragments produced from 600 MeV proton induced fission of a uranium carbide target has been used to measure the mass excess of 49,50K and 40,42Cl. The experimental data is presented. (AIP)
